Trusted By

SaaS Development Services

We offer end-to-end Software as a Service (SaaS) development services, covering the entire lifecycle. Our experienced team of developers leverages the latest technologies to build scalable, secure, and feature-rich SaaS applications that meet your needs and launch products quickly.

iocn01

SaaS App Development

We build custom SAAS applications after deeply understanding the client's business, goals, and target audience. With our SAAS development services, enjoy no tricky installations, expensive maintenance, and annoying updates.

iocn01

SaaS App Consulting

Our expert SAAS consultants will guide you with detailed plans and accurate cost estimates for maximum returns. We will find the perfect tech solutions for your business goals and ensure they fit your project needs well.

iocn01

SaaS App Design

With our SAAS app design and prototype services, you can see how your product will look before launch. Our UI/UX specialists study your business concept, focusing on functionality and aesthetics to maximize its value.

iocn01

Third-Party Integrations

Integrate third-party APIs effortlessly into your SaaS solutions. Whether REST, JSON, or SOAP, we use cutting-edge tech to make these integrations fast and precise, boosting your product's functionality and user experience.

iocn01

SaaS Migration Services

With our experienced SAAS developers, migrate your on-premise product to a subscription-based SaaS model. We ensure seamless implementation that fits your business needs and budget.

iocn01

SaaS Architecture Design

We design SaaS architectures that ensure optimal performance and reliability. Our multi-tenancy architectures scale seamlessly, enabling your solution to handle peak loads without compromising performance.

Moon Technolabs' Approach to SAAS App Development

Our approach to SaaS development involves strategic planning, leveraging next-gen technology, and years of expertise to deliver impactful solutions. We engage with your team from inception to post-launch maintenance, ensuring a seamless development process.

Beginning with thorough research and analysis, we delve into understanding your target audience, market trends, and competitors. Next, we use agile methodologies, allowing flexibility and adaptability throughout the project lifecycle. We prioritize user-centered design and create intuitive interfaces to deliver user experiences and drive user engagement and satisfaction.

icon01

Extensive SaaS App Development

Our expertise in building SaaS solutions spans across diverse industries and use cases. With a deep understanding of SaaS architectures, multi-tenancy models, and cloud technologies, we build future-proof applications that deliver seamless user experiences, robust security, and high availability.

ios_iocn01

CRM Solutions

We build feature-rich CRM solutions that provide 360-degree customer views, automate lead management, optimize sales pipelines, track customer interactions, and make data-driven decisions.

ios_iocn01

ERP Solutions

We develop ERP systems that integrate and optimize core business processes, like inventory, finance, supply chain, etc. Our ERP solutions enable businesses to make informed decisions, improve efficiency, and reduce costs.

ios_iocn01

E-commerce Solutions

We create user-friendly, responsive e-commerce platforms with robust shopping carts, secure payment gateways, and order management systems. Our e-commerce solutions drive customer acquisition, retention, and revenue growth.

ios_iocn01

AI & ML SaaS Solutions

Leveraging artificial intelligence & machine learning, we build intelligent SaaS platforms offering personalized and data-driven experiences. Our AI-ML solutions enable businesses to deliver tailored recommendations and dynamic content.

Ready To Turn Your Idea Into Powerful SaaS Solutions?

Partner with Moon Technolabs to expand your digital presence with innovative technologies.

Our Achievements

clutch
star

Got 4.9 Stars by Recognized as "Top App Development Company" by Clutch.

clutch

Job Success Score 100%

Got "Top Rated" Badge with 100% of Job Success on Upwork.

clutch
star

Got 4.8 Stars as "Top Mobile App Development Company" by GoodFirms.

clutch
star

Got 5.0 Stars as "Professional Development Services Company for Hiring" by Bark.

Successful Case Studies of SAAS Development Projects

Explore how our custom SaaS solutions have helped businesses across various industries to streamline operations, drive innovation, and unlock new growth opportunities.

Moon Invoice
Moon Dialer
SSH Client

Moon Invoice

Moon Invoice is a comprehensive accounting software app designed for time and expense tracking to optimize business expenses and enhance profits with accurate billable hours. It offers free trials and subscription packages payable via PayPal. Available on iOS, macOS, Android, Web, and Windows, it features a user-friendly interface, a web admin panel for user management...

Category

  • Business

Tech Stack

  • Laravel
  • php
  • CodeIgniter

Moon Dialer

Moon Dialer leverages Voice Over Internet Protocol (VoIP) to enable cost-effective voice calls via broadband connections. It supports calls to phone numbers worldwide, offering one of the best dialing platforms in the industry. Designed with the latest technology trends, Moon Dialer stands out as a top VoIP application, ensuring clear and reliable communication for users...

Category

  • Telecom

Tech Stack

  • Swift
  • Twilio
  • VoIP

SSH Client

Our SSH Client provides a seamless and secure way to connect to remote devices, making it one of the finest SSH-Telnet apps available. Renowned for its robust structure and user-friendly interface, it offers a comprehensive remote solution for network engineers. Constantly updated based on real-world usage and customer feedback, our SSH Client includes powerful features...

Category

  • Business

Tech Stack

  • Objective-C
  • Swift
  • X-Code

Client Testimonials

Discover what sets our SaaS development services apart straight from our valued clients who have successfully achieved business growth. Our custom SAAS solutions have delivered the desired results and exceeded expectations.

Future-Proof Your Business with Scalable SaaS Solutions.

Maximize efficiency and profitability with Custom SaaS Solutions tailored to your needs.

SaaS App Development Process

We follow a streamlined five-step approach that covers everything from initial planning to continuous improvement. Our user-centric process, driven by ongoing research and dedication to refining our expertise, ensures we deliver intuitive, user-friendly SaaS applications.

process_image

1. Discovery and Planning

  • Understand Business Goals.
  • Conduct Market Research.
  • Decide Project Scope and Resources.

2. Design and Prototyping

  • Create Wireframes and Prototypes
  • Define features
  • Define Technical Requirements

3. Development & Integration

  • Implement the design and architecture
  • Iterative development and continuous integration
  • Integrate security measures and APIs

4. Testing and Quality Assurance

  • Perform various tests
  • Identify and fix bugs
  • Verify compliance

5. SAAS App Submission

  • Deploy SAAS App
  • Monitor performance and uptime
  • Gather user feedback and analytics

Frameworks for SaaS App Development

Our SAAS development experts leverage robust frameworks and technologies to build scalable, secure, high-performing SaaS solutions. Our future-ready SaaS applications streamline operations and unlock new growth opportunities.

Django

Django is a high-level Python web framework. It provides built-in authentication, database migrations, and admin interface features, making it suitable for building secure and scalable SaaS applications.

Symfony

Symfony offers a modular architecture to create flexible and scalable SaaS products. Its features, such as routing, caching, security, and dependency injection, are ideal for building exceptional SaaS solutions.

Laravel

Laravel is a PHP web framework that provides features like authentication, routing, and caching out of the box, enabling developers to build powerful and maintainable SaaS applications easily.

Vue.js

Vue.js is a progressive JavaScript framework. It offers a simple and flexible architecture, virtual DOM rendering, and reactive data binding, making developing interactive and responsive UI components easy.

React

React is a JavaScript library for building user interfaces in SaaS applications. It offers a component-based architecture, virtual DOM rendering, and state management capabilities.

Angular

Angular is a TypeScript-based web application framework. It provides comprehensive features for building SPAs, including two-way data binding, dependency injection, and routing capabilities.

Docker

Docker's containerization platform enables easy scalability & consistent performance across diverse environments. It offers tools for container management, minimizing operational burdens, & optimizing SaaS performance.

Golang

Golang offers concurrency support, garbage collection, and a multi-paradigm approach, making it ideal for real-time communication apps, databases, and high-performing SaaS products.

What We Can Build Together?

service_image

Being a leading SAAS development company, we have proven expertise in building scalable and innovative SaaS solutions. We leverage advanced technologies, agile processes, and a user-centric approach to deliver future-proof solutions tailored to your unique business needs on time and within budget.

    service_image

    Let’s Build Your Future-proof SaaS Application

    We will help you create secured cloud-based solutions at reduced costs.

    Looking for other App Development Services?

    Explore our wide range of app development services designed to bring your innovative ideas to life, tailored to meet your unique business needs.

    FAQs

    01

    What are the benefits of SaaS development for businesses?

    SaaS development offers several benefits, including cost-effectiveness, scalability, flexibility, accessibility, automatic updates, and reduced IT infrastructure requirements. It also allows businesses to focus on their core competencies while leveraging the expertise of SaaS providers.

    02

    How long does it take to build a SaaS application?

    The development timeline for a SaaS application can vary depending on the project scope, complexity, features, and integration requirements. Typically, developing and launching a SaaS application can take 5-12 months to complete. We ensure that projects are delivered within the stipulated timeline.

    03

    What technologies do you use in SaaS development?

    Common technologies we use in SaaS development include programming languages such as Java, Python, Ruby, and JavaScript. Frameworks like Node.js, Django, and Ruby on Rails are popular, along with cloud platforms like AWS, Azure, and Google Cloud.

    04

    How do you ensure data security in SaaS development?

    Data security is a top priority in SaaS development. We implement industry-standard security measures such as encryption, authentication, access control, and regular security audits to protect user data from unauthorized access, breaches, and cyber threats.

    05

    Can you customize SaaS applications to suit our business needs?

    We offer custom SaaS development services tailored to your unique business requirements. Our team works closely with you to understand your needs and objectives, ensuring that the SaaS application aligns with your vision and delivers the desired outcomes.

    06

    Do you provide ongoing support and maintenance for SaaS applications?

    We offer comprehensive support and maintenance services for SaaS applications post-launch. Our team is available to address any issues, provide updates, implement enhancements, and ensure the smooth operation of your SaaS application over time.

    07

    How do you handle scalability in SaaS development?

    Scalability is a key consideration in SaaS development to accommodate growing user bases and increasing demands. We design and architect SaaS applications with scalability in mind, leveraging cloud infrastructure and scalable technologies to handle traffic spikes and growth seamlessly.

    08

    How can I connect with the project manager?

    You can connect with the project manager and the development team through Skype, Google Meet, or Zoom. We provide prompt assistance for your queries and concerns.

    Top Blogs

    Stay informed and inspired with our selection of expertly curated blogs covering a wide range of topics and industries.

    top-bottom